Refreshment Cool Post is a convenient and refreshing quick-service location located at Epcot’s World Showcase in Walt Disney World Resort, Florida. This kiosk-style eatery offers guests a variety of chilled beverages and frozen treats, providing a welcome respite from exploring the diverse cultural offerings of World Showcase.

Refreshment Cool Post is a popular spot for guests seeking to cool down and quench their thirst with a selection of cold drinks, including sodas, bottled water, and various non-alcoholic specialty beverages. The kiosk also offers a range of frozen treats, such as ice cream novelties and refreshing fruit popsicles, perfect for satisfying sweet cravings on a warm day.

With its convenient location near other African-themed attractions and entertainment, Refreshment Cool Post is an excellent spot for guests to take a break, recharge, and enjoy a quick treat while continuing their World Showcase adventure.

Fun Facts

  • Refreshment Cool Post is a snack kiosk located in Epcot’s World Showcase at Disney World.
  • The kiosk offers a variety of refreshing and frozen treats, making it a popular spot for visitors looking to cool off and enjoy a tasty snack while exploring the World Showcase.
  • One of the signature items at Refreshment Cool Post is the “Frozen Coke,” a slushy drink that is perfect for quenching your thirst on a hot day in the park.
  • The location also offers other frozen beverages, including lemonade and occasionally special seasonal offerings.
  • Refreshment Cool Post is conveniently situated near the African Outpost and the Germany Pavilion, making it a convenient stop for guests as they travel around the World Showcase.
